Dodge
Most of the WC21's are to be found in Queensland where they were sold by the disposals people, a few more have turned up down in the Southern states but QLD is the place.
The AWM collection has pics of rows of WC21's lined up at the Mt. Gravatt vehicle park. The ARN range is around 129xxx from memory . I've had a few of them , one was a ex tow truck, still LHD found at Creswick Vic. I passed on all of my Dodge stuff to a VMVC member years ago. I had another one with the ARN number on the tailgate 129166 ? could be wrong its been along time. The Creswick Dodge was flat towed home by the Growse No.9 Chev gun tractor .
